How much do part time building maintenance j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time building maintenance in Idaho is $25.63,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.56 and $31.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a part time building maintenance job?

Part time building maintenance jobs involve performing routine repairs, upkeep, and troubleshooting for buildings on a part-time basis. Workers in this role may handle tasks such as fixing plumbing or electrical issues, painting, cleaning, and maintaining heating or cooling systems. These positions often require basic handyman skills and flexibility to address urgent repairs as needed. Part time schedules can vary, making this job suitable for those seeking flexible hours or supplemental income. Building maintenance staff play a key role in ensuring a safe and functional environment for occupants.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time building maintenance worker?

To thrive as a Part Time Building Maintenance worker, you need basic knowledge of building systems, repair techniques,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hand and power tools, safety protocols, and sometimes experience with maintenance management software are typ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ication help workers prioritize tasks and interact with tenants or supervisors. These skills and qualities ensure timely repairs, safe facilities, and efficient operations in building environments.

What are the most common challenges faced by part time building maintenance staff, and how can they be managed effectively?

Part-time building maintenance staff often face the challenge of balancing multiple tasks within limited work hours, such as handling urgent repairs alongside routine upkeep. They may also encounter scheduling conflicts when coordinating with full-time staff or contractors. Effective time management, clear communication with supervisors, and staying organized are key to overcoming these challenges. Additionally, familiarizing oneself with the layout and systems of the building early on can help streamline responses to maintenance requests.

What is the difference between Part Time Building Maintenance vs Part Time Janitorial Worker?

AspectPart Time Building MaintenancePart Time Janitorial Worker
CertificationsBasic maintenance or safety certifications often preferredCleaning certifications or training may be advantageous
Work EnvironmentFacilities, mechanical rooms, building interiorsOffices, restrooms, hallways, commercial spaces
Employer & IndustryProperty management, commercial buildings, schoolsCommercial cleaning companies, schools, offices
Job FocusRepairs, equipment maintenance, inspectionsCleaning, sanitation, trash removal

Part Time Building Maintenance involves performing repairs, inspections, and general upkeep of building systems, often requiring basic technical skills. In contrast, Part Time Janitorial Worker primarily focuses on cleaning and sanitation tasks. Both roles are essential for facility upkeep but differ in scope and skill requirements.

Job description

Our maintenance employees work behind the scenes to make sure that building and equipment are in working order and that the restaurant looks its best for our customers. This position typically begins as soon as the store opens and the job is complete before lunch. Part-time positions can leave before lunch, while full-time maintenance persons take on second roll, and work as a cook or in guest service through the lunch hour.
The Essential Recipe:
• Must be a morning person. This position typically works an early morning shift.
• The maintenance position requires attention to detail and the ability to work independently.
• Maintenance responsibilities include a morning cleaning routine, regular equipment tuning and periodic cleaning projects.
• Maintenance responsibilities typically take between 3 to 4 hours per day
All we ask is that you:
• Are at least 16 years old.
• Must be able to lift up to 50 lbs.
• Maintain a positive attitude
• Are able to walk or stand during your entire shift
